Core Aspects Your Wetsuit Demands
When choosing a wetsuit, understanding the essential features is vital for maximizing performance and comfort in the water. A well-fitted wetsuit guarantees reduced water entry, improving thermal insulation and buoyancy. The thickness of the neoprene material is critically important; typically, a 3mm to 5mm thickness is recommended depending on water temperature.
Sealed seams are another important feature, as they prevent water from leaking through, maintaining warmth during extended sessions. Flexibility is vital for free movement, making features like ergonomic panels and strategic cutouts necessary. Additionally, a reliable zipper system, whether back or front, should allow easy entry and exit while remaining watertight.
Finally, examine supplementary components like hardened knee areas for resilience and wrist and ankle closures for a firm fit. These features collectively contribute to an enhanced diving undertaking, assuring both comfort and results in assorted water sports events.

Measuring Your Body Measurements
Achieving the ideal fit for a diving wetsuit depends on accurate body measurements. To commence, one must obtain a flexible measuring tape and take several vital measurements: chest, waist, hips, inseam, and height. The chest measurement is important for ensuring that the suit fits comfortably around the torso, while the waist and hip measurements help adjust the fit around the midsection and lower body. The inseam comprehensive resource measurement supports determining the length of the legs, making sure proper coverage. Finally, height establishes an overall scale for the suit's dimensions. It is recommended to wear minimal clothing while measuring for the most precise results. Exact measurements will greatly enhance comfort and performance in water sports, ensuring a superior diving experience.
Comprehending Diving suit Thickness Options
When deciding on a wetsuit, grasping the various thickness options is essential for ideal comfort and performance in different water conditions. Wetsuits typically span 2mm to 7mm in thickness, affecting flexibility and insulation. A 2mm suit is suitable for warm water, providing minimal thermal protection while allowing freedom of movement. In contrast, a 5mm wetsuit provides a balance for cooler waters, ensuring adequate warmth without compromising flexibility. For frigid conditions, a 7mm suit is recommended, delivering maximum insulation but potentially limiting mobility. It's important to factor in personal tolerance to cold, the duration of water exposure, and activity type when choosing a thickness. Ultimately, the right fit improves both comfort and performance during aquatic adventures.
Heat Control: Preserving Thermal Energy in Frigid Waters
In cold water zones, capable temperature maintenance is necessary for maintaining safety and well-being during water sports. Heat-retaining suits are built to secure a thin layer of water against the skin, which warms up from body heat, establishing an insulating barrier. The thickness and material of a wetsuit markedly shape its thermal performance; neoprene is the standard choice due to its remarkable thermal attributes.
Furthermore, wetsuits typically feature technologies including sealed seams and thermal linings to enhance temperature maintenance. The fit of the wetsuit remains essential; a fitted design limits water exchange, avoiding the loss of warmth.
In colder conditions, divers and surfers may opt for supplementary equipment including head coverings, hand protection, and foot coverings to maximize thermal protection. By recognizing these aspects of thermal regulation, aquatic athletes can determine proper equipment to ensure a pleasant experience in cold water.

Instructions for Protecting Your Water Suit
Proper care for a wetsuit can markedly prolong its lifespan and copyright its operation. After every use, it is critical to rinse the wetsuit meticulously with clean water to remove salt, sand, and chlorine that can degrade the composition. Avoid harsh detergents; instead, opt for wetsuit-specific cleaners.
As it air-dries, the wetsuit should be suspended turned inward in a protected spot, away from direct sunlight, which can fade the colors and deteriorate neoprene. Positioning the wetsuit extended or on a wide hanger prevents creasing and maintains its shape.
Regularly check for signs of wear, such as rips or seepage, and repair them immediately to prevent additional harm. Finally, avoid stepping on the wetsuit when donning or removing it, as this can lead to unnecessary stretching or tearing. Proper attention guarantees peak performance and pleasure in water sports.

Can a Wetsuit be used for Purposes Other than Diving?
Yes, wetsuits can be put on for assorted water activities, including surfing, paddleboarding, and snorkeling. They give warmth retention, buoyancy, and protection against friction, making them flexible for assorted water climates and environments.
How Do I Properly Keep My Wetsuit?
To correctly store a wetsuit, rinse it in fresh water, dry it away from direct sunlight, and hang it on a wide hanger. Avoid folding to prevent creases and maintain the suit's condition.
What Markers Show a Damaged Wetsuit?
Signs of wetsuit wear include visible tears, thinning material, peeling neoprene, and weakened seams. Also, water leaks during use or an unusual odor may indicate deterioration, calling for repair or replacement for peak function.
Do Diving suits Produce Skin Irritation?
Yes, wetsuits can lead to skin irritation due to factors like improper fit, material allergies, or extended wear. Manifestations may feature red patches, rubbing discomfort, or hypersensitive reactions, encouraging users to explore alternative materials or better-fitting options.
When Should I Substitute My Wetsuit Regularly?
Wetsuits should generally be changed every three to five years, depending on how often you use them and care. Signs of wear, such as fading or compromised seams, indicate that it's necessary to replace it to maintain functionality.
